Warning: file_get_contents(/data/phpspider/zhask/data//catemap/3/android/192.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181

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/solr/3.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ript 不变冲突:此导航器缺少导航道具。在导航4中_Javascript_Android_Reactjs_React Native_Expo - Fatal编程技术网

Javascript 不变冲突:此导航器缺少导航道具。在导航4中

Javascript 不变冲突:此导航器缺少导航道具。在导航4中,javascript,android,reactjs,react-native,expo,Javascript,Android,Reactjs,React Native,Expo,我正在尝试为我的React本机应用程序创建一个导航抽屉,使用两个屏幕、主屏幕和连接屏幕,但我一直收到以下错误: Invariant Violation: The navigation prop is missing for this navigator. In react-navigation 3 you must set up your app container directly. More info: https://reactnavigation.org/docs/en/app-co

我正在尝试为我的React本机应用程序创建一个导航抽屉,使用两个屏幕、主屏幕和连接屏幕,但我一直收到以下错误:

Invariant Violation: The navigation prop is missing for this navigator. In 
react-navigation 3 you must set up your app container directly. More info: 
https://reactnavigation.org/docs/en/app-containers.html
请问我的密码有什么问题。 我的App.js:

import React from 'react';
import Search from './Components/Search'
import { createDrawerNavigator } from 'react-navigation-drawer'
import { createStackNavigator,createAppContainer } from 'react-navigation'
//import  Connection from './Screens/ConnectionScreen';
import  AccueilScreen from './Screens/AccueilScreen';

export default class App extends React.Component {
  render(){
    return (
      <AppDrawerNavigator/>
        );
  }

}

const AppDrawerNavigator = createDrawerNavigator({
  //Se_Connecter: Connection,
  Accueil:{ 
    screen : AccueilScreen,
  },
});
const AppNavigator= createAppContainer(AppDrawerNavigator);
从“React”导入React;
从“./Components/Search”导入搜索
从“react navigation drawer”导入{createDrawerNavigator}
从“反应导航”导入{createStackNavigator,createAppContainer}
//从“/Screens/ConnectionScreen”导入连接;
从“/Screens/AccuelScreen”导入AccuelScreen;
导出默认类App扩展React.Component{
render(){
返回(
);
}
}
const AppDrawerNavigator=createDrawerNavigator({
//Se_连接器:连接,
Accueil:{
屏幕:AccuelScreen,
},
});
const AppNavigator=createAppContainer(AppDrawerNavigator);

您在不使用AppContainer(您创建的)的情况下呈现
抽屉驱动程序

导出默认类App扩展React.Component{
render(){
返回(
);
}
}

您在不使用AppContainer(您创建的)的情况下呈现
抽屉驱动程序

导出默认类App扩展React.Component{
render(){
返回(
);
}
}

这是否回答了您的问题?这回答了你的问题吗?非常感谢,我没有注意那个细节。问题不在这里了,多亏我没有注意到那个细节。问题已经不存在了
export default class App extends React.Component {
  render(){
    return (
      <AppNavigator/>
    );
  }
}